Sony PSP2 Mobile Game Console
The latest generation of PSP mobile gaming console has been introduced, namely PSP2. PSP2 has 5-inch sensitive touch-screen, OLED, PSP2 also has more powerful processor than the previous version.

PSP2 also comes with two cameras, one on each side. An additional touchpad on the back to allow additional new options to control the game. PSP2 could be used for online via the 3G network or Wi-Fi. Thus, the user can stop the game via the console in their home and play it back via mobile devices, which can also be used for location-based services.

PSP2 is not capable for 3D, but allows for a similar 3D games, with a rear touchpad and dual analog sticks. Game for the PSP2 will be immediately available on the Playstation Suite site.

Sony VAIO Y Series
Latest Sony VAIO Y Series notebooks powered by AMD processors. With the new AMD platform, users can play HD content smoothly and more comfortable. If the VAIO Y Series (VPCYA) equipped with Intel Core i3-380UM, then latest VAIO Y Series (VPCYB) equipped by processor E-350 AMD Dual Core and AMD Radeon HD 6310 Discrete-Class Graphics.

Accelerated Processing Unit (APU) from AMD is a single chip that combines high-performance AMD dual-core processors, as well as discrete-class graphics that supports Microsoft DirectX 11. Vision Technology from AMD offers the clear and smooth HD experience, including play HD video comfortably. Internet operations also much faster through VPCYB.

Overall, the VAIO Y Series equipped with 11.6-inch screen with high resolution of 1366 x 768 for fast and smooth operation, lightweight 1.46 pounds, making it easy to carry anywhere. This notebook also equipped with ergonomic touch panel to control the precise gestures to Genuine Microsoft Windows 7, and various supporting applications. VAIO Y Series (VPCYB) is available in silver, pink, and green.

Sony Ericsson Aspen
Greenpeace has been several years routinely conduct audits of electronic products and perform rating based on the measurable environmental aspects.

Most green smartphone of Greenpeace version in 2010 fall into the Sony Ericsson Aspen, beat five other nominated smartphone, the Nokia N800, Samsung GT-S8500 (Wave), HP Palm Pixi Plus, the BlackBerry Pearl 3G, and Dell Aero.

Sony Ericsson Aspen using the Windows operating system version 6.5, this smartphone is available in QWERTY and Touchscreen. It is also equipped with WiFi, 100 MB of storage and also social media features like Facebook and Twitter.

This was announced at the International Consumer Electronics Show 2011 in Las Vegas beginning in January 2011 some time ago. This smartphone meets defined 4 categories of Greenpeace, which is free of hazardous materials, low power consumption, product life cycles, as well as innovation and marketing strategy.

Greenpeace Research conducted has shown that Sony Ericsson Aspen free of toxic materials like PVC and BFRs. Sony Ericsson Aspen Smartphone, introduced in February 2010 was also declared free from Phtalate and Beryllium.

Sony Ericsson Xperia Play
Rumors are stating Sony will make the phone with the features of the PlayStation Portable game console apparently not a figment. The phone is named Sony Ericsson Xperia Play.

Reported by Engadget, Thursday (01/27/2011), Sony Ericsson Xperia Play starts with a code name Zeus, as the number R800i. According to Engadget, the Xperia Play has Bluetooth SIG Certification, but the wifi doesn't work properly, perhaps because of this is a new prototype only.

From the design, Xperia Play has a smaller size than the PlayStation Portable, but almost equal to the size of other Sony Ericsson phones. Only when the folder is shifted then saw a mix PlayStation and Sony Ericsson.

The top has 4 inches touch screen and reinforced with Bravia Mobile Engine screen, supported a resolution of 854x480 pixels. The bottom of the screen was equipped with a manual button. But not the phone keypad, but like the PlayStation Portable game console.

Xperia Play is equipped with 1GHz Qualcomm MSM8655 chipset, coupled with Adreno 205 graphics chip for convenient display in game play. Both processors and graphics that offer a quite remarkable speed with 512 MB RAM capacity to strengthen the performance of embedded operating systems, the Android 2.3 Gingerbread.

Sony Ericsson Xperia Play also comes with a 5 megapixel camera with Exmor image sensor. Thus Xperia Play capable of recording video with 800x480 resolution.

Qriocity Digital Music Services
LONDON - Sony announced that Qriocity, their cloud-based digital music service is now available in France, Germany, Italy and Spain. The service, launched in the UK and Ireland in December 2010, provides to its users access to millions songs catalog from Sony Music, Universal Music Group, Warner Music Group, and EMI Music, as well as several independent labels. Similarly, as quoted by TechCrunch, Sunday (01/23/2011).

Users can play music at any time through devices like the Sony BRAVIA TVs, Blu-ray Disc player, Blu-ray Disc Home Theater System and the PlayStation 3. Qriocity service comes with two options: Basic (3.99 Euro per month) and Premium (9.99 Euro per month).

Previous launches 'Video On Demand powered by Qriocity' a video streaming service in the U.S. in April 2010 and access services to France, Germany, Italy, Spain and the UK in November 2010. Sony said that Qriocity streaming video service will be available in Japan on January 26.
